How It Unfolded
The points were shared at Seoul World Cup Stadium, Regular Season - 8, as FC Seoul and Daejeon Citizen drew 2-2 in the K League 1. The remainder of the report sets that outcome against the pre-match model, the markets and the teams' data profiles.
The Model vs The Result
The Poisson model went into this projecting FC Seoul 1.33 xG and Daejeon Citizen 1.67 xG, a combined 3.00. The scoreboard read 2-2 for 4 actual goals. Both sides finished within a goal of their individual projections, so the scoreline sat close to the model's expected shape. Those figures were built on strength ratings of FC Seoul attack 1.14 / defence 0.99 against Daejeon Citizen attack 1.60 / defence 1.01, drawn from 40/41 games (CurrentSeason).
On the result, the model split it FC Seoul 31% | Draw 24% | Daejeon Citizen 45%, with Daejeon Citizen to win its most likely call at 45%. Instead the game produced a draw, an outcome the model had rated at just 24% — a clear break from expectation and a genuine upset by the numbers.
